Shifting to Positive Thinking
The good news is that you have the power to change that narrative. Positive thinking doesn’t just happen overnight; it requires intention and practice. When you start to intentionally replace negative thoughts with positive affirmations, you reclaim your power. Start small—every time a negative thought enters your mind, challenge it. Ask yourself, “What evidence do I have that supports this thought?” You might find that the foundation of your fear is weaker than you thought.

Practical Tips for Cultivating Positive Thinking
- Practice Gratitude: Begin and end each day by listing three things you’re grateful for. This simple exercise shifts your focus from what’s lacking to what you appreciate.
- Surround Yourself with Positivity: Spend time with people who uplift and inspire you. Their energy will nourish your own positive thinking.
- Engage in Positive Self-Talk: Speak to yourself as you would to a friend. Replace harsh criticism with encouragement and embrace your achievements, no matter how small.
- Visualize Success: Close your eyes and envision your goals. Feel the success in your bones—this technique can fortify your belief in your capabilities.
